WebMay 5, 2024 · To do that, you will need the following tools: pliers, an Allen key, a wrench (according to the size of the bolt), and wire cutters. The first step is to get rid of the old cable. To do that, you need to pull the cable out of the brake lever on your handlebar and from the actual brake. After that, you can remove the old cable from the housing.

WebNov 23, 2010 · 1) Go to bike store and ask for end cap. Usually free... Crimp it on with any old pair of pliers 2) Dip the end cable in a little epoxy of super glues (this is what I do). 3) Use a benzo torch to cut the cable or, even melt the end (My local bike shop does this -very slick!).
